How to Migrate to Australia: Requirements & Processes

Embarking on a move to Australia involves understanding a series of specific requirements and processes. The initial stage usually involves determining your eligibility for a suitable permit. Australia utilizes a points-based system for many professional migration programs, evaluating factors such as years, qualifications, work experience, and language proficiency. You’ll need to prove these through assessments and documentation. Common options include skilled independent visas, family-sponsored visas, and employer-sponsored visas. A skilled visa typically requires a endorsement from a state or territory government, and possibly a skills assessment from a recognized assessing authority. Family visas often require a supporter who is an Australian citizen or copyright. The entire procedure can be lengthy and requires careful planning, including gathering substantial evidence and potentially engaging with a registered migration advisor.
